Capacity note: the Brindlewood profile store is approaching the comfortable ceiling of a single primary, so we are moving to hash-based sharding on account identifier. Shard count is fixed at creation; resharding requires a full migration window, so choose generously. Rebalancing thresholds and per-shard connection budgets were validated during the Marrow Lake load tests. Current production values are set by these constants.

constants for tafog-kahag:
RATE_LIMITS = {
    "sorir": 697,
    "oliox": 683,
    "holax": 176,
    "casox": 60,
    "pelius": 382,
}

The Marlowind JavaScript and Python SDKs reached feature parity in release 3.8: both now support batched uploads, cursor pagination, and webhook signature verification. The only remaining gap is streaming responses, scheduled for 3.9. Parity is verified nightly by the cross-SDK conformance suite against the Tarnfield staging cluster. To run the suite manually before sign-off, authenticate the harness with the bearer token below.

session JWT of yawep-yawep = eyJhbGciOiJIUzI1NiIsInR5cCI6IkpXVCJ9.eyJzdWIiOiI3pWF3_In0.aXYsHiog

Action item (P2): The Veldrane validator plugin system loaded third-party validators without checking schema version compatibility, which caused the March outage when the Quillfork plugin silently dropped records. Future maintainers must ensure the registry rejects plugins compiled against mismatched schema versions and logs the rejection with the plugin name. Owner: platform team, target next quarter. The full compatibility matrix and the rejection-handling design notes are documented on the internal wiki page linked below.

wiki page, tahaf-tajog: https://jira.ordindyn.corp/pipeline

## Authentication

Fonts vendored from the Quillforge foundry mirror are fetched at build time, never at runtime, so release artifacts remain fully offline. The fetch step verifies checksums against the lockfile before copying into `assets/fonts`. The mirror endpoint requires authentication on every pull; for release builds, use the key provided below.

gateway credential: kto23_LX9A4ys6i4nzHtpOLNLodKK